So if you deposit $1,000 into a CD with a 2.00% APY and an early withdrawal penalty of 60 days’ interest, your penalty would be: $1,000 x (0.02/365) x 60 = $3.29. Weighing Early Withdrawal Fees

The penalty for early withdrawal deters depositors from taking advantage of subsequent better investment opportunities during the term of the CD. In rising interest rate environments, the penalty may be insufficient to discourage depositors from redeeming their deposit and reinvesting the proceeds after paying the applicable early withdrawal ...
